Game story
In Week 5 of the 2001 NFL season on 2001-10-14, the New Orleans Saints took care of business against the Carolina Panthers, pulling away with a 27–25 final that came down to the wire.
The highest-scoring period was Q4 with 20 combined points — the stretch that most shaped the final margin.

How it unfolded, quarter by quarter
A quarter-by-quarter recap built from live scoring plays and play descriptions.
The opening quarter: New Orleans Saints won the period 10–0. New Orleans Saints found the end zone from the CAR 11 (Q1 54:02) — (9:02) 2-A.Brooks pass to 85-C.Cleeland for 11 yards, TOUCHDOWN.; New Orleans Saints added 1 points from the CAR 2 (Q1 53:57) — 3-J.Carney extra point is GOOD, Center-47-K.Houser, Holder-4-T.Gowin.; New Orleans Saints connected on a field goal from the CAR 12 (Q1 50:41) — (5:41) 3-J.Carney 30 yard field goal is GOOD, Center-47-K.Houser, Holder-4-T.Gowin..
The second quarter: New Orleans Saints won the period 7–6. New Orleans Saints found the end zone from the CAR 16 (Q2 42:56) — (12:56) 2-A.Brooks pass to 85-C.Cleeland for 16 yards, TOUCHDOWN.; New Orleans Saints added 1 points from the CAR 2 (Q2 42:49) — 3-J.Carney extra point is GOOD, Center-47-K.Houser, Holder-4-T.Gowin.; Carolina Panthers connected on a field goal from the NO 29 (Q2 34:08) — (4:08) 4-J.Kasay 46 yard field goal is GOOD, Center-56-J.Kyle, Holder-10-T.Sauerbrun.; Carolina Panthers connected on a field goal from the NO 35 (Q2 31:11) — (1:11) 4-J.Kasay 52 yard field goal is GOOD, Center-56-J.Kyle, Holder-10-T.Sauerbrun..
The third quarter: Carolina Panthers won the period 6–3. Carolina Panthers found the end zone from the NO 9 (Q3 19:38) — (4:38) 16-C.Weinke pass to 81-D.Hayes for 9 yards, TOUCHDOWN. Penalty on NO-59-K.Mitchell, Defensive Holding, declined.; New Orleans Saints connected on a field goal from the CAR 21 (Q3 15:10) — (:10) 3-J.Carney 39 yard field goal is GOOD, Center-47-K.Houser, Holder-4-T.Gowin..
The fourth quarter: Carolina Panthers won the period 13–7. Carolina Panthers found the end zone from the NO 23 (Q4 3:50) — (3:50) 16-C.Weinke pass to 85-W.Walls for 23 yards, TOUCHDOWN.; Carolina Panthers found the end zone from the CAR 81 (Q4 2:04) — (2:04) 4-T.Gowin punts 51 yards to CAR 30, Center-47-K.Houser. 89-S.Smith for 70 yards, TOUCHDOWN.; Carolina Panthers added 1 points from the NO 2 (Q4 1:48) — 4-J.Kasay extra point is GOOD, Center-56-J.Kyle, Holder-10-T.Sauerbrun.; New Orleans Saints found the end zone from the CAR 1 (Q4 0:00) — (:00) 34-R.Williams left end for 1 yard, TOUCHDOWN.; New Orleans Saints added 1 points from the CAR 2 (Q4 0:00) — 3-J.Carney extra point is GOOD, Center-47-K.Houser, Holder-4-T.Gowin..
